/*
BY RICHARD TUDOR HARRIS
sidemenu.css
*/
#sidemenu{
	display: block;
	width: 163px;
	padding: 0px;
	margin: 0px;
	background: url(../images/sm_bg.gif) repeat-y;
}
#sidemenu img{
	clear: both;
	margin: 0px;
	padding: 0px;
}
#sidemenu ul{
	display: block;
	width: 150px;
	margin: 0px;
	padding: 0px 6px 0px 7px;
}
#sidemenu li{
	display: block;
	float: left;
	width: 150px;
	list-style: none;
	margin: 0px;
	padding: 0px;
}
#sidemenu strong{
	display: none;
}
#sidemenu li ul {
	display: none;
	width: 150px;
	margin: 10px 0px 10px 0px;
	padding: 0px;
}
#sidemenu #sidemenutop{
	width:163px;
	height: 5px;
	margin:0px;
	padding: 0px;
	background: url(../images/sm_top.gif) no-repeat;
}
#sidemenu #sidemenubot{
	clear:both;
	width:163px;
	height: 5px;
	margin:0px;
	padding: 0px;
	background: url(../images/sm_bot.gif) no-repeat;
}
/*
	menu 01
	TABLE FOOTBALL
*/
#sidemenu li#sidemenu_01 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_01.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_01 a.on,
#sidemenu li#sidemenu_01 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_01.jpg) bottom no-repeat;
}
/*
	menu 02
	MULTIGAMES TABLES
*/
#sidemenu li#sidemenu_02 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_02.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_02 a.on,
#sidemenu li#sidemenu_02 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_02.jpg) bottom no-repeat;
}
/*
	menu 03
	TABLE TENNIS
*/
#sidemenu li#sidemenu_03 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_03.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_03 a.on,
#sidemenu li#sidemenu_03 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_03.jpg) bottom no-repeat;
}
/*
	menu 04
	POOL & SNOOKER
*/
#sidemenu li#sidemenu_04 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_04.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_04 a.on,
#sidemenu li#sidemenu_04 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_04.jpg) bottom no-repeat;
}
/*
	menu 05
	AIR HOCKEY
*/
#sidemenu li#sidemenu_05 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_05.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_05 a.on,
#sidemenu li#sidemenu_05 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_05.jpg) bottom no-repeat;
}
/*
	menu 06
	ARCADE GAMES
*/
#sidemenu li#sidemenu_06 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_06.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_06 a.on,
#sidemenu li#sidemenu_06 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_06.jpg) bottom no-repeat;
}
/*
	menu 07
	DARTS
*/
#sidemenu li#sidemenu_07 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_07.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_07 a.on,
#sidemenu li#sidemenu_07 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_07.jpg) bottom no-repeat;
}
/*
	menu 08
	ELECTRIC TOYS
*/
#sidemenu li#sidemenu_08 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_08.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_08 a.on,
#sidemenu li#sidemenu_08 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_08.jpg) bottom no-repeat;
}
/*
	menu 09
	JUKEBOXES
*/
#sidemenu li#sidemenu_09 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_09.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_09 a.on,
#sidemenu li#sidemenu_09 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_09.jpg) bottom no-repeat;
}
/*
	menu 10
	CASINO TABLES
*/
#sidemenu li#sidemenu_10 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_10.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_10 a.on,
#sidemenu li#sidemenu_10 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_10.jpg) bottom no-repeat;
}
/*
	menu 11
	OUTDOOR LEISURE
*/
#sidemenu li#sidemenu_11 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_11.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_11 a.on,
#sidemenu li#sidemenu_11 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_11.jpg) bottom no-repeat;
}
/*
	menu 12
	CONTEMPORARY FURNITURE
*/
#sidemenu li#sidemenu_12 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_12.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_12 a.on,
#sidemenu li#sidemenu_12 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_12.jpg) bottom no-repeat;
}
/*
	menu 13
	FITNESS EQIPMENT
*/
#sidemenu li#sidemenu_13 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_13.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_13 a.on,
#sidemenu li#sidemenu_13 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_13.jpg) bottom no-repeat;
}
/*
	menu 13 sub
	FITNESS EQIPMENT
*/
#sidemenu li#sidemenu_13 #sub_13{
	width: 150px;
	margin: 10px 0px 10px 0px;
	padding: 0px;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_1 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_01.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_1 a.on,
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_1 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_01_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_2 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_02_new.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_2 a.on,
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_2 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_02_on_new.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_3 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_03.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_3 a.on,
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_3 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_03_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_4 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_04.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_4 a.on,
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_4 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_04_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_5 a{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_05.gif) top  no-repeat;
}
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_5 a.on,
#sidemenu li#sidemenu_13 #sub_13 li#sub_13_5 a:hover{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/fq_05_on.gif) top  no-repeat;
}
/*
	menu 14
	BRANDING & PERSONALISATION
*/
#sidemenu li#sidemenu_14 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_14.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_14 a.on,
#sidemenu li#sidemenu_14 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_14.jpg) bottom no-repeat;
}
/*
	menu 14 sub
	BRANDING & PERSONALISATION
*/
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_1 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/bp_01.gif) top  no-repeat;
}
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_1 a.on,
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_1 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/bp_01_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_2 a{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/bp_02.gif) top  no-repeat;
}
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_2 a.on,
#sidemenu li#sidemenu_14 #sub_14 li#sub_14_2 a:hover{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/bp_02_on.gif) top  no-repeat;
}
/*
	menu 15
	PUBS & CLUBS
*/
#sidemenu li#sidemenu_15 a{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_15.jpg) top  no-repeat;
}
#sidemenu li#sidemenu_15 a.on,
#sidemenu li#sidemenu_15 a:hover{
	display: block;
	width: 150px;
	height: 35px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/menu_15.jpg) bottom no-repeat;
}
/*
	menu 15 sub
	PUBS & CLUBS
*/
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_1 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_01.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_1 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_1 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_01_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_2 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_02.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_2 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_2 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_02_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_3 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_03.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_3 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_3 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_03_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_4 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_04.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_4 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_4 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_04_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_5 a{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_05.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_5 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_5 a:hover{
	display: block;
	width: 150px;
	height: 23px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_05_on.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_6 a{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_06.gif) top  no-repeat;
}
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_6 a.on,
#sidemenu li#sidemenu_15 #sub_15 li#sub_15_6 a:hover{
	display: block;
	width: 150px;
	height: 36px;
	margin: 0px;
	padding: 0px;
	background: url(../images/menu/sub/pc_06_on.gif) top  no-repeat;
}